Vancouver's Visier Launches “Know Code?” Campaign To Attract Top Developers

Dec 19 2017, 7:39 pm

Visier, the innovation leader in workforce analytics and planning, will be launching a billboard advertising campaign to entice Vancouver’s best software developers and tech talent to apply for jobs at the rapidly growing startup. The billboards will be posted at three locations throughout the city starting next week.

The billboard advertising campaign is part of Visier’s overall push to attract star talent across all disciplines. The company is tripling the size of its workforce over the next year to meet the growing demand for its existing Applied Big Data solutions, and to innovate new solutions in high growth areas. This will create 120 new positions at Visier over the next year, 90 of which will be at Visier’s Vancouver headquarters, with at least 60 of these new positions covering technical fields (including software developers, QA engineers, and project managers).

Visier was founded in 2010 by Ryan Wong (former Senior Vice President of Engineering for the Business Intelligence Platform at SAP, and Chief Architect and VP of Engineering at Business Objects),  and John Schwarz, CEO, Visier (former CEO for Business Objects, and member of SAP board).

Over the past year, the company has released two new product offerings (Visier Workforce Planning and Visier Workforce Benchmarking) and doubled its customer count. The company also nearly doubled the size of its workforce, opened a new office in San Jose, and expanded its Vancouver headquarters into a new, larger facility. Recent company contract wins have included Yahoo, City of Edmonton, NetApp, Exelon, McGraw Hill Financial, Time Inc., Baker Hughes, and USG Corporation. In the wake of securing $25.5 million in series C financing in June 2014, Visier is continuing on its accelerated growth trajectory, experiencing triple revenue growth.
